Big guns fire on grand final day

A huge summer of tennis came to a thrilling conclusion on the weekend with grand finals being played in the Berwick District Tennis Association (BDTA).

The Pakenham Regional Tennis Centre (PRTC) came alive as players from right across the region enjoyed the thrill and atmosphere of the biggest day of the season.

Beaconsfield Blue won the prestigious Rob Osborne Shield, while Tooradin’s Section-16 team were very proud to hold the Bill Kucks Shield.
